PLAYERS TO BANK ON, BROUGHT TO YOU BY THE UNITED BANK AND TRUST

1A Regional Tournament in Baileyville 2/22-2/27

2/25 B&B 47 Frankort 45 (Boy‘s Semi-final)
Wildcat Senior Wade Ahlvers wrapped up an outstanding high school basketball career by scoring a team-high 16 in a losing effort. He scored seven points in the third quarter, helping Frankfort go into the fourth quarter up two.

Hanover 44 Axtell 21 (Boy‘s Semi-final)
On an off night for the Wildcats offensively, Senior Taylor Nicholson was the only player on the team in double figures, finishing with ten points along with four blocks.

2/26 Frankfort 45 Hanover 39 (Girl‘s Semi-final)
Lady Wildcat Senior Allison Bruna had a game-high 15 points and kept her team in the ball game by scoring 11 in the second half.

Bern 43 B&B 42 (Girl‘s Semi-final)
Junior Laura Baumgartner scored seven points in the fourth quarter and finished with a team-high 11.

2/27 Frankfort 71 Bern 46 (Girl‘s Championship)
Senior Erica Dwerlkotte led three Lady Wildcat players in double figures with 18, nine coming in the third quarter.

Hanover 50 B&B 44 (Boy‘s Championship)
Senior Jerod Diederich and the Wildcats went into the fourth quarter trailing by two, but his six points in the final frame helped guide Hanover to victory. He scored a game-high 18, 12 coming after halftime.
